    I have WIN 10 PRO. I back-Up EVERY Day with Macrium Reflect 6 and run Malwarebytes which scans & updates every night. During the past 4 weeks I have NOT Downloaded any FREEWARE Programs, just Unlocker last month. The Malwarebytes did a scheduled scan at 2:00 AM and found "PUP.Optional.Babylon". There were Files & Folders, 6 to be exact. Malwarebytes removed them all. I also run Norton Internet Security. How did this Malware get in ??

  3. Borg 386 Win User
    The most probable sources are download hosting sites (such as CNet) which have a habit of adding unwanted programs to the package in order to make some money. There are also sites that have "drive by downloads," where the site has a hidden macro command in the background. Just visiting this site is enough to start the d/l of a program without your knowledge.

    If you are downloading any new programs, go to the source/authors site & get it directly from there. If you are running Firefox, the NoScript add on will stop drive by downloads in most instances. Do not use "standard" or "express" settings when installing a program, go to the custom installation to be sure nothing is included in the installation such as tool bars. In most instances nowadays, PUP's are bundled in with software installers & need to be manually unchecked.

    It could very well have put something in. In an effort to make money on "free" software, more & more companies are choosing to bundle PUP's into their software to make a buck. Even getting something from a legitimate site doesn't guarantee they won't try to sneak something in. The more legitimate companies will present the PUP right up front giving you the option to not install it. The sneakier ones will bundle it & give you no clue, even if you check the "custom" install.

    I used a couple programs in the past that I no longer use because, although they were good programs, they now include toolbars/add ons which you can not opt out of. Basically, their TOS said "You will install this added program if you want to use our software." So I said goodbye.
